首页 >

PHP加密工具选择,ioncube和ZendOptimizer各自的优点是什么? |phpcms模板 新闻网

php post 接受xml数据,php给字符串加单引号,php经典实例,apache 500 index.php,php 无限分类类,php 获取网络文件数据格式,phpcms卸载旧模块,html php for循环,phpcms模板 新闻网PHP加密工具选择,ioncube和ZendOptimizer各自的优点是什么? |phpcms模板 新闻网

ZendOptimizer(ZendGuard):

1、ZendGuard只能对带有PHP标记或源码的文件进行加密,对于其他不带有PHP标记的文本方式保存的文件不能进行加密操作。

2、ZendGuard只能用于配置了ZendOptimizer的环境中,不能独立运行。

3、ZendGuard在PHP4下的错误,对于PHP4的绝对路径及相对路径在加密时会出现较大的差别。

4、支持PHP4.2.X~5.2.X版本的加密。

5、使用的ZendOptimizer(PHP引擎)可以提高源码20~50%以上的速度优化,结合ZendGuard可以提高至50%以上的性能速度优化,且ZendOptimizer可以安装于当前较多主流系统中。

ionCube:

1、ionCube不仅可以加密带有PHP标记或源码的php文件还可以对非php文件的以text方式保存的文件进行加密操作,如xml,js,css等。(但是读写时必须使用ionCube所提供的读入API进行读写操作。)

2、ionCube在功能方面经过测试可以优胜于Zend公司的ZendGuard,不仅支持期限,注册码,等加密方式,还支持对IP,MAC地址等复杂的加密方式。

3、可加密的PHP版本从PHP4.0.6~5.2.X(比ZendGuard高2个级别)。

4、ionCube与Zend一样,为了提高PHP性能优化也提供了相应的PHP引擎,可以为大多数操作系统提供PHP优化功能,但是可惜的是,至今未提供Windows版本的PHP引擎。

5、ZendGuard在PHP4下的错误,在ionCube中没有出现,可以看出ionCube相对稳定。

6、对于ionCube来说,对带有PHP标记或源码的文件采用压缩加密方式处理,对于非php的文本类文件则采用加密方式处理。在读入时必须使

用“ioncube_read_file/ioncube_write_file”读写文件。因此在使用ionCube加密前需要对相应的PHP代码,进行改造后才能使用。

可以看出对于ionCube与ZendGuard来说各有优缺点,因此在选择产品时需要根据项目及代码情况来决定采用何种工具进行处理。

关于二者更加详细的比较,请看下图:


PHP加密工具选择,ioncube和ZendOptimizer各自的优点是什么? |phpcms模板 新闻网
  • steam打开商店总显示错误代码? - 网络|
  • steam打开商店总显示错误代码? - 网络| | steam打开商店总显示错误代码? - 网络| ...

    PHP加密工具选择,ioncube和ZendOptimizer各自的优点是什么? |phpcms模板 新闻网
  • 身份证区域代码表怎么做? - 网络|
  • 身份证区域代码表怎么做? - 网络| | 身份证区域代码表怎么做? - 网络| ...

    PHP加密工具选择,ioncube和ZendOptimizer各自的优点是什么? |phpcms模板 新闻网
  • css初始化代码怎么写 |css absolute ie6
  • css初始化代码怎么写 |css absolute ie6 | css初始化代码怎么写 |css absolute ie6 ...